A Poetic Break

Success

To laugh often and much;
to win the respect of intelligent people
and the affection of children;
to earn the appreciation of honest critics
and endure the betrayal of false friends;
to appreciate beauty; to find the best in others;
to leave the world a bit better,
whether by a healthy child,
a garden patch
or a redeemed social condition;
to know even one life has breathed easier
because you have lived.
This is to have succeeded.

Ralph Waldo Emerson - (1803-1882)

Book Review

Review of Jonathan Livingston Seagull, Richard Bach

This is a fun book that causes you to pause and think, and the good thing about it is you can read it in less than an hour. You can also read it to your children, they'll love the images.

This book is about Jonathan Livingston Seagull, one of many seagulls from the Breakfast Flock colony. The gulls dodged and fought for food off fishing boats, except for Jonathan Livingston, who would practice soaring into the sky, doing various manoeuvres not intended for gulls. Jonathan would soar and then glide. Though he stalled and fell many times, he picked himself up and practiced some more. He learned from his mistakes and kept on "course correcting."

Bach writes, "For most gulls, it is not flying that matters, but eating. For this gull, though, it was not eating that mattered, but flight. More than anything, Jonathan Livingston Seagull loved to fly." Jonathan's attitude made him unpopular, even his parents were disappointed in him, but that didn't deter him. Jonathan refused to conform. "His mother asked. "Why is it so hard to be like the rest of the flock, Jon? Why can't you leave low flying to the pelicans, the albatross? Why don't you eat? Son, you're bone and feathers."

"I don't mind being bone and feathers, mom. I just want to know what I can do in the air and what I can't, that's all. I just want to know."

Though Jonathan failed many times, got discouraged and tried to conform, the passion, fire in his belly, and the drive to be better, forced him to try harder. Being a very introspective gull, he would deconstruct to determine what he did and make improvements. One day he went too far, so thought the Council Gathering who summoned him to "Stand to Center for Shame." Jonathan was banished from the colony.

All alone he kept on learning, "What he had hoped for the Flock, he now gained for himself alone; he learned to fly, and was not sorry for the price that he had paid. Jonathan Seagull discovered that boredom and fear and anger are the reason that a gull's life is so short, and with these gone from his thought, he lived a long fine life indeed."

There is a Jonathan Livingston Seagull inside each of us, let's release him today!

Survey Results


Vacation Days

The average vacation days received:

France - 39 days
Great Britain - 27 days
Germany - 24 days
Canada - 19 days
Australia - 17 days
Americans - 14 days

Source: http://www.benefitnews.com/work/detail.cfm?id=9115

How Did They Do That?

Challenge: The main business challenge that I face, is one faced by most small businesses, which is securing new business, and figuring out the best strategy to do so. Do you advertise, network, rely on word of mouth, or use a combination of the three? If you're not careful, you can waste time and money networking and advertising.

Resolution: In my business, as the budget for advertising is modest, I try to secure publicity where possible. I developed cartoons about the pitfalls of the television industry. I had the idea to run the cartoons in Playback Magazine, a recognized industry magazine. When the cartoons are published my company's name is attached to it. I am hoping this will generate new business, but if it doesn't that's okay because I already had the cartoons, and the magazine is doing all the other work that's necessary.

Also, I am very strategic about networking, and have declined many invitations and just focus on the events that are related to my business with my target customers.
I would also like to talk about another way I secured new business. I developed a course and presented it to a few educational institutions. These institutions were very interested but did not have funds set aside in the budgets to run the workshop in a consistent manner. After growing increasingly frustrated with the long decision-making process, I decided to offer the course myself out of my offices, and I have been generating income from this new revenue stream.

If the institutions decide to offer my course, that's great, if not, that's great as well because what I am doing right now is working.

Lessons Learned

  1. When you have a dollar be careful how you spend it, because when it's lost or not spent wisely, it's very difficult to recover it
  2. When things are going well in your business, put aside some of the funds to tide you over when there is a lull
